Output 345c8bde4c2930b363441db44e986bc1bfc5de5b437217ea359eeba1776b27ff:0

value
1061323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2530f4eaef8679138b93181bced0bc80859c968 OP_EQUAL
address
3Ls7KvY1gVBjzXpzdXu5vfh2B6EWfS4xgz
transaction
345c8bde4c2930b363441db44e986bc1bfc5de5b437217ea359eeba1776b27ff
spent
true